Llandovery is a small market town nestled between the rugged scenery of the Brecon Beacons National Park and the gentler Upper Towy Valley. Situated in Camarthenshire, the area is renowned for its castles and historically was home to lead and gold mining, notably Dolaucothi now open to the public. Nearby is Llyn y Fan Fach, most famous for the legendary Lady of the Lake, a myth still alive today.
Llandovery College is the focal point of this friendly town and perfectly placed to explore the Brecon Beacons and surrounding scenery, its tranquillity making it the ideal place for students to concentrate on their studies.
Set in 55 acres of grounds, OISE Llandovery benefits from excellent sports, recreational and fitness facilities, including a nine-hole golf course.
